Digital Dust Trails: A Digital Forensics Analyst's Perspective

In the dynamic realm of digital investigations, every click, download, and interaction leaves behind a subtle yet significant trail - what we refer to as "digital dust trails." This ephemeral remnants hold valuable clues for skilled digital forensic analysts like myself. By meticulously examining these traces, we can reconstruct events, identify perpetrators, and uncover hidden truths. A compelling aspect of this field is the ever-evolving nature of technology. As cybercrime becomes increasingly sophisticated, so too must our investigative techniques.

Take, a seemingly innocuous web search can reveal a trove of data about an individual's interests, habits, and even their location. On the other hand, deleted files often leave behind fragmented fragments that can be assembled with specialized tools. This our duty as digital forensic analysts to decode these intricate digital narratives, providing vital evidence in legal proceedings and aiding in the pursuit of justice.

The Silent Witness: Poison Detection in Forensic Toxicology

In the realm of criminal investigations, poisons often conceal themselves as invisible culprits. Forensic toxicologists act as mute witnesses, meticulously analyzing biological samples to reveal the presence of these deadly substances. Their expertise plays a essential role in solving complex situations. Through a spectrum of sophisticated techniques, forensic toxicologists can pinpoint the type of poison, its amount, and the way in which it was administered. These findings provide invaluable clues to investigators, helping them construct a persuasive case against the perpetrator.

The forensic toxicology laboratory is a treasure trove of scientific tools and expertise. Highly technicians utilize advanced apparatus to examine blood, urine, tissue samples, and even hair. These analyses can disclose the detection of a wide selection of poisons, from common household cleaners to potent toxins. The field of forensic toxicology is constantly advancing, with new techniques emerging to counteract the growing threat of poisoning.
